GB/T 19749.3-2022
ActiveCoupling capacitors and capacitor dividers—Part 3: AC or DC coupling capacitor for harmonic-filters applications
耦合电容器及电容分压器 第3部分:用于谐波滤波器的交流或直流耦合电容器
Application Summary AI generated
This standard specifies performance requirements, testing methods, and rating parameters for AC or DC coupling capacitors used in harmonic filter applications within power systems. It is applied to capacitors installed in high-voltage transmission and distribution networks to suppress harmonics and improve power quality, particularly in industrial settings with non-linear loads like variable frequency drives or arc furnaces. The standard ensures these capacitors can withstand the specific electrical stresses and operating conditions encountered in harmonic filtering circuits.
